ageless.....13 years old ripping off a track record 1:52.1 mile at Rosecroft

Old bones but the trainer and owner have really looked after him. Racing at high level conditioned or open type trots whether it be Harrington, Rosecroft or Chester. This isnt like former champs Vivid Photo or currently Dealt A Winner racing poorly in cheap races at advanced ages. I believe some of his earnings get donated to charitable causes and he is closing in on another 100K season

Hope harness racing does something special to promote him at age 14. I believe the first trotter to go sub 150 and did he win like 17 races in a row or something like that his 4 year old season en route to a Dan Pactch award in 2015. Amazing career and too bad he had a couple of nagging injuries after that 4 year old season that kept him from hitting on all cylinders. You want to talk about all time durable war horse trotters. I would say he may have to top the list.

Jl Cruze's winnings have built many water wells in some African towns that never had clean drinking water before. The owner is an 83 year old well driller that has donated the time and money that saves lives. many lives.
 This is a story that needs to be told on a national level .
